A plate of sliced homemade lemon bars. Lemon bars, as well as many other dessert bars are typically baked in the oven in a 9×13 inch baking pan. [11] The bars are baked in two steps. [1] First, the crust is baked part of the way to ensure that it will not combine with the lemon curd and can support it. [1]
